2011-12-22 30 views
0

给出不叫我想要实现在asp.net一个简单的404重定向在IIS6托管在Windows 2003中IIS 6的HttpModule时的路径没有扩展

我创建了一个HTTP模块,并正确注册它的网络。配置。重定向完美的作品时,我使用了“开发服务器”(CTRL + F5)在2005年VS重定向适用于这两个场景:

  1. 当提供了一个不存在的页面的扩展名(www.example的.com/page2.htm)
  2. 当未设置的延伸部(www.example.com/abc)

然而,当我主办IIS6相同的应用程序,方案(1)的工作,因为它是 - 但它遇到情况时无法处理(2)

我尝试添加一个通配符脚本映射,但这是没有帮助 - 我得到一个404错误消息由IIS给出..

如何处理这个 - 在web.config或IIS中的一些设置?

谢谢,

回答